Our second guest is Dennis Stone, owner of America’s Stonehenge, a site in the heart of New Hampshire that has boggled researchers for generations. Including details such as astro-archeologic alignments, winding stone walls and large stone structures, the site has a storied history dating to before anglo-settlers arrived.
